CARE International in Ghana is seeking a qualified candidate to fill the position of Head of Programmes

Job Summary

The Head of Programs (HoP) is responsible for ensuring that CARE's programs in Ghana contribute to CARE's vision of "a world of hope, tolerance and social justice, where poverty has been overcome and people live in dignity and security". The HoP is expected to provide strategic leadership in the areas of program  strategy and development, implementation, monitoring and evaluation of programs(including emergency programs), influencing policy and quality assurance. S/he is responsible for coordinating resource mobilisation for program delievry, working with the program team and the wider CARE international members. S/he ensures that systems and people are in place for proper management of programs.

Key Responsibilities

•   Oversee the development, implementation, monitoring and evaluation of country office programs and projects and ensure that they are in line with Country Office (CO) and the Care International(CI) Program Strategies.
•   Work with staff and partners to generate viable programs in line with CO program strategy and assist in identifying and securing funding for those programs
•   Ensure that Gender Equality and Diversity (GED) issues are properly considered and addressed in all programs/projects.
•   Ensure that CARE programs and projects are managed in a manner which achieves the program/project goals, is in line with CARE policies and procedures and demonstrate sound resource management
•   Ensure proper management of financial and other resources entrusted to CARE's programs and projects, including the review and approval of program/project budgets (including project matches) and the monitoring of budget reports (including the proper recording of matches).
•   Work closely with units in Program Support (finance, admin and HR) to ensure proper coordination exists for efficient program implementation.
•   Regularly review and ensure that the most efficient CO program management structure is established and functional in order to ensure program quality and the cost efficient achievement of programt objectives.
•   Ensure that robust systems are in place to gather evidence for advocacy, resource mobilization, publication and sharing in the wider organization
•   Establish mechanisms for knowledge sharing and learning between projects and programs within the CO and with parties beyond the CO.
•   Lead the preparation and implementation of the overall CO Program Strategy in line with the global CI program Strategy, national development plans and the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
•   Oversee periodic review of the operating environment and ensure CARE’s role and operating model are in line with that environment.
•   Seek stratgeic partnerships necessary to promote CARE's vision and programming principles.
•   Establish and maintain good relationships with relevant – counterparts/departments of the government, CI members, the locally-represented multi/bi-lateral donors, foundations, private sector, international and national NGOs, CBOs and other civil society organizations.
•   Identify issues to be addressed to heighten donor and government accountability and maintain a positive image and good visibility for CARE amongst these groups.
•   Provide proper supervision and management for all direct reports and lead the establishment and functioning of a strong, effective and coordinated Program team. Build a strong programme team by providing support in the form of coordination, planning, prioritization, coaching and supervision to all programme staff.
•   Ensure the proper implementation of CARE's performance management system for direct reports, including job description and Annual Performance Agreement and Assessment (APAA) development, regular feedback, mid-term reviews and annual performance appraisals.
